Amotekun: A vote of no confidence in Buhari, says PDP

The Peoples Democratic Party has said that the setting up of a joint security outfit, Amotekun, by governors of the six states in the Southwest, was an indication of vote of no confidence in President Muhammadu Buhari’s handling of the security situation in the country.

It also noted that the failure of the Federal Government to prosecute the war against acts of terrorism beyond lip service and condolence statements had emboldened the killers. The PDP recalled that the Federal Government had failed to prosecute the masterminds of the mass killings in Benue, Nasarawa, Bauchi, Taraba, Kogi, Adamawa, Borno, Yobe, Zamfara, Kaduna, Ekiti and other parts of the country.
